From neighbourhood adventures to family trail outings, this built-for-kids mountain bike makes it easy for young riders. The frame design and components inspire confidence and control, helping them develop their off-road skills.

Off-road control
A shorter seat tube with a lower bottom bracket and standover height creates a lower centre of gravity with greater stability and manoeuvrability on dirt paths and trails. Talon 24 models come with a 50mm suspension fork for added control on bumpy terrain.

Kid-sized components
Smaller diameter handlebars and short-reach brake levers offer better grip and control for smaller hands. Shorter cranks ensure smooth pedalling and prevent the pedals from hitting the ground while cornering.

All the accessories
A kickstand, mini fender and bell make Talon 24 a fun and easy bike for everyday rides around the neighbourhood.

TALON 24 KIDS' BIKE
A lower bottom bracket and standover height gives the Talon 24 a lower centre of gravity, making it easier for young riders to control the bike. A shorter seat tube, combined with kid-specific components including handlebars designed for smaller hands and shorter cranks, gives young riders added stability and comfort for riding off-road. A kickstand, mini-fender and bell are included.
Technical Information
  • Colours
    Metallic Blue
  • Sizes
    One size
  • Frame
    ALUXX-Grade aluminium
  • Fork
    Custom Suspension, 50mm
  • Shock
    N/A
  • Handlebar
    Giant kids tapered, alloy, 31.8mm
  • Grips
    Giant Junior
  • Stem
    Forged alloy Ahead, 10-degree
  • Seatpost
    Alloy, 27.2mm
  • Saddle
    Explora Jr
  • Pedals
    Platform
  • Shifters
    Shimano REVOSHIFT, 1x7
  • Front Derailleur
    N/A
  • Rear Derailleur
    Shimano Tourney
  • Brakes
    Mechanical disc [F]160mm, [R]140mm rotors
  • Brake Levers
    Alloy, junior MTB
  • Cassette
    14x34
  • Chain
    KMC HV500
  • Crankset
    Alloy, 32t, 140mm
  • Bottom Bracket
    Semi-cartridge
  • Rims
    Giant Kids 24", alloy
  • Hubs
    QR Alloy, 28h
  • Spokes
    Stainless, 14g
  • Tyres
    Giant Junior Sport 24x1.95"
  • Extras
    Bell, kickstand
Sizing Information
Sizing to be used as a reference only. Please check us in-store to determine the correct size.

One Size: 130 cm to 150 cm (rider height)
